    WCCH (103.5 FM) is a low-power college radio station broadcasting in the Holyoke, Massachusetts, United States, area. The station is owned by Holyoke Community College . [ 2 ] WCCH airs a variety of programming 24/7.

    Boston University, Northeastern, and Harvard joined the planning process soon thereafter. Holyoke was selected as the location on June 11, 2009. The specific site was announced on August 9, 2010; a century ago the site had housed a textile mill. [9] Ground was broken on October 5, 2011. The topping off ceremony occurred on November 29, 2011.
